Witold Filipczyk
688ca8cf31
ECMAScript: evaluating onclick, onsubmit etc. done in the right way.
...
Scripts such as onsubmit are called as a function not as a script.
2007-05-19 20:54:08 +02:00
Witold Filipczyk
a29ef8600c
DOM: SEE in not supported yet.
2007-05-19 20:43:41 +02:00
Witold Filipczyk
e887efc611
onsubmit: Reverted commit fa93d05b7e
.
...
I don't remember why I cleared "returns", but it doesn't work
with www.hypermedia.pl/altkom/ and probably with many more sites.
2007-05-19 18:47:20 +02:00
Witold Filipczyk
6da89f7acc
DOM: Definition of attribute callback.
2007-05-16 21:26:07 +02:00
Witold Filipczyk
e53f3b2c99
DOM: Added add_document_callback and redefined the other callbacks.
2007-05-16 21:21:52 +02:00
Witold Filipczyk
c6a8822926
shadow: Draw transparent shadow like Turbo Vision.
2007-05-16 13:42:36 +02:00
Witold Filipczyk
29bfa86d5d
DOM: Added a placeholder for cleaning html_data.
2007-05-13 20:14:43 +02:00
Witold Filipczyk
5626d6499f
DOM: Added the html_data field to the struct dom_element_node.
...
html_data will be used by the future renderer.
2007-05-13 19:58:11 +02:00
Witold Filipczyk
9edc009c10
DOM: Added callbacks when adding an element or an attribute.
2007-05-13 19:46:39 +02:00
Witold Filipczyk
d6c844288a
DOM: Node_finalize and done_dom_node_ecmascript_obj.
...
There should be no dangling pointers to ecmascript_obj.
TODO: Pointer to the root node is needed for performance.
2007-05-13 14:32:33 +02:00
Witold Filipczyk
26966b85bd
DOM: Added DOM2-HTML stubs.
2007-05-12 22:26:30 +02:00
Witold Filipczyk
afae921507
DOM: added enums for DOM2-HTML.
...
Redefined also enums for DOM3-Core in such a way that none of enums
has positive value.
2007-05-12 15:15:23 +02:00
Witold Filipczyk
2252f8d8a9
DOM SpiderMonkey: Typos.
2007-05-10 21:09:45 +02:00
Witold Filipczyk
df573e56e3
DOM: SpiderMonkey's DOM implementation started.
...
Added placeholders of functions and properties.
2007-05-10 21:04:07 +02:00
Witold Filipczyk
a2f18bb6fc
deflate: Used -MAX_WBITS instead of hard coded -15.
2007-05-08 15:28:33 +02:00
Witold Filipczyk
d09334df72
cgi: Set HTTP_ACCEPT_ENCODING.
2007-05-08 09:35:04 +02:00
Witold Filipczyk
f2859f529e
encoding: added deflate.
...
Based on the bzip2 backend. It works (checked with the lighttpd and the PHP
zlib.deflate filter).
2007-05-05 18:57:47 +02:00
Witold Filipczyk
c364abd748
bug 949: Stupid, but works.
...
Previously object_unlock in push_delete_button_common caused an assertion
failure.
2007-05-02 17:48:06 +02:00
Witold Filipczyk
0f2a24229f
bug 949: call done_download_display.
2007-05-02 17:31:40 +02:00
Witold Filipczyk
98450fad79
bug 949: do not remove the downloaded file on abort.
2007-05-02 16:59:41 +02:00
Witold Filipczyk
31768f129a
bug 949: Abort button works.
2007-05-02 09:29:39 +02:00
Witold Filipczyk
d26410d0ff
bug 397: It works for download_manger. I hope this don't break anything.
2007-05-01 22:07:33 +02:00
Jonas Fonseca
910087ff13
Make non-standard pluginspage attribute to embed hyperlinkable
...
Appears on page reachable from links on
http://www.gilbertogil.com.br/sec_discografia_view.php?id=17
2007-05-01 20:37:08 +02:00
Laurent MONIN
d5acb25a08
Prevent internal errors when terminal width or height are very small
...
(1x1 was fatal).
2007-05-01 20:37:03 +02:00
Laurent MONIN
e1332c29ce
Insert newlines and remove parenthesis in -version and Info box display.
2007-05-01 20:36:49 +02:00
Laurent MONIN
6bed8f1503
Fix trailing whitespaces
2007-05-01 20:36:04 +02:00
Laurent MONIN
c496a7eaf6
Enhance version and features display. Wrap on spaces when features
...
are sent to console using -version, and let Info dialog do the job in
interactive mode.
2007-05-01 20:32:52 +02:00
Kalle Olavi Niemitalo
75dbfdb7e2
ELinks 0.13.GIT.
...
There is a now separate elinks-0.12 branch for the upcoming 0.12.0 release.
2007-05-01 20:32:38 +02:00
Kalle Olavi Niemitalo
1c9165e931
Bug 712, ssl_set_no_tls: Disable TLS protocols for GnuTLS too.
...
And log this in NEWS, although that may have to be reverted later if
it turns out this change just hides a real bug elsewhere in ELinks.
2007-05-01 20:28:27 +02:00
Simon Josefsson
8c53b32be7
Use gnutls_set_default_priority.
...
Thereby enabling TLS 1.2 on GnuTLS versions that support it.
2007-05-01 20:28:18 +02:00
Kalle Olavi Niemitalo
e2f26e45f8
l_pipe_read: Don't leak the old block if mem_realloc fails.
2007-05-01 20:28:12 +02:00
Kalle Olavi Niemitalo
b195975a27
Bug 945: Don't crash if the error message is not a string.
2007-05-01 20:27:16 +02:00
Kalle Olavi Niemitalo
4766314960
Bug 941: Survive an unexpected number of 227 or 229 FTP responses.
...
And document the functions a little.
[ From commit 71ff470f2e
in ELinks
0.11.2.GIT. --KON ]
2007-05-01 20:24:36 +02:00
Kalle Olavi Niemitalo
792bb98e58
charset_list: Map the "System" codepage to the underlying one.
...
If LC_CTYPE=fi_FI.ISO-8859-15, and terminal.*.charset = System,
then the charset menu will select ISO 8859-15 by default.
2007-05-01 20:24:20 +02:00
Kalle Olavi Niemitalo
4821d841c7
do_move_bookmark: Update comment to match reality.
...
[ From commit 22d051925e
in ELinks
0.11.2.GIT. --KON ]
2007-05-01 20:23:34 +02:00
Kalle Olavi Niemitalo
37ca87a01e
do_smb: URI-encode the username and password.
...
I tested that this does the right thing for the username "Kalle %50"
(encodes it to "Kalle%20%2550", and libsmbclient then decodes back).
2007-05-01 20:23:29 +02:00
Kalle Olavi Niemitalo
33319cd842
do_smb: Don't decode_uri.
...
libsmbclient will decode the URI on its own, so if ELinks does that too,
file names like "2%200" will be incorrectly handled.
2007-05-01 20:22:07 +02:00
Kalle Olavi Niemitalo
9418f3d508
TAGS: Doh, don't forget to scan the *.[ch] files.
2007-05-01 20:22:02 +02:00
Kalle Olavi Niemitalo
64159aa70a
TAGS: Scan *.inc too. Recognize the ACTION_ macro.
2007-05-01 20:21:57 +02:00
Kalle Olavi Niemitalo
13acf06876
Don't mark undisplayed names of modules for translation.
...
Exclude unneeded header files. This partially reverts commit
90980a944e
, with permission.
2007-05-01 20:21:50 +02:00
Kalle Olavi Niemitalo
ac818c4837
report_scripting_error: Look up module names with gettext.
2007-05-01 20:21:42 +02:00
Laurent MONIN
a4f1b7e489
Mark all module names for translation and include needed header files.
2007-05-01 20:20:15 +02:00
Kalle Olavi Niemitalo
36ce51f912
ftp: Decode strftime results from the system codepage.
2007-05-01 20:20:09 +02:00
Kalle Olavi Niemitalo
605d04378f
add_cp_html_to_string: New function.
...
To be used when strings from gettext or strftime must be inserted
into an HTML document with a potentially different charset.
2007-05-01 20:20:04 +02:00
Kalle Olavi Niemitalo
269a8f4397
ftp: Collect HTML formatting parameters into a structure.
2007-05-01 20:19:58 +02:00
Kalle Olavi Niemitalo
21bdcad9c7
ftp: Allocate a larger buffer for the timestamp string.
2007-05-01 20:19:53 +02:00
Kalle Olavi Niemitalo
b636024ede
ftp: Don't pad the timestamp column with spaces.
2007-05-01 20:19:48 +02:00
Kalle Olavi Niemitalo
d696d6530f
show_http_error_document: Generate a charset parameter.
2007-05-01 20:19:41 +02:00
Kalle Olavi Niemitalo
b29655f25f
file: Directory listings are in the system charset.
...
Give them a corresponding Content-Type header. This must go in
cached->head because cached->content_type is supposed to be just
type/subtype. It will also be deduced from cached->head, so don't set
it separately.
2007-05-01 20:19:34 +02:00
Kalle Olavi Niemitalo
55bce38eee
struct directory_entry: Document the charset and mem_free.
2007-05-01 20:19:29 +02:00